The hexadecimal color code #ECCFA6 corresponds to the code RGB( 236, 207, 166 ). It's a shade of Orange. This color is a combination of red (at 0,93 level), green (at 0,81 level) and blue (at 0,65 level). Its brightness is 78% and its saturation is 64%. It is composed of red at 38%, green at 33% and blue at 27%.
